Title: Generalization of the Randall-Sundrum warped braneworld model to higher dimensions

The Randall-Sundrum warped braneworld model is generalized to six and higher dimensions such that the warping has a nontrivial dependence on more than one dimension. This naturally leads to a brane-boxlike configuration along with scalar fields with possibly interesting cosmological roles. Also obtained naturally are two towers of 3 branes with mass scales clustered around either of the Planck scale and TeV scale. Such a scenario has interesting phenomenological consequences including an explanation for the observed hierarchy in the masses of standard model fermions.
